OECD 443 Regulatory Recommendations

January 10, 2022
The Extended One Generation Reproductive Toxicity Study (EOGRTS, EU B.56, OECD TG 443) has been the information requirement for reproductive toxicity under the Registration, Evaluation, Authorization, and Restriction of Chemicals (REACH, Annexes IX and X, Section 8.7.3.) since March 2015. In July 2021, an evaluation of 12 test cases of the Organisation for Economic Cooperation and Development (OECD) 443 study led by the European Chemicals Agency (ECHA) revealed critical issues with study designs that had the potential to compromise data analysis and interpretation. This infographic outlines the resulting regulatory recommendations and the subsequent potential impact of these recommendations upon study design that can be taken into account to improve ongoing and future EOGRT studies.
